[−][src]Struct job_scheduler::Job
A schedulable Job

Methods
impl<'a> Job<'a>
[src]
pub fn new<T>(schedule: Schedule, run: T) -> Job<'a> where
T: 'a,
T: FnMut(),

Create a new job.
ⓘThis example is not tested
// Run at second 0 of the 15th minute of the 6th, 8th, and 10th hour // of any day in March and June that is a Friday of the year 2017. let s: Schedule = "0 15 6,8,10 * Mar,Jun Fri 2017".into().unwrap(); Job::new(s, || println!("I have a complex schedule...") );
pub fn limit_missed_runs(&mut self, limit: usize)
[src]
Set the limit for missed jobs in the case of delayed runs. Setting to 0 means unlimited.
ⓘThis example is not tested
let mut job = Job::new("0/1 * * * * *".parse().unwrap(), || { println!("I get executed every 1 seconds!"); }); job.limit_missed_runs(99);
pub fn last_tick(&mut self, last_tick: Option<DateTime<Utc>>)
[src]
Set last tick to force re-running of missed runs.
ⓘThis example is not tested
let mut job = Job::new("0/1 * * * * *".parse().unwrap(), || { println!("I get executed every 1 seconds!"); }); job.last_tick(Some(Utc::now()));
